Ingredients
– 2 cups flour β Forms the base for tender cake layers.
– 1 ΒΎ cups sugar β Sweetens the batter and aids browning.
– ΒΎ cup cocoa powder β Delivers intense chocolate flavor.
– 1 Β½ tsp baking powder β Helps the cake rise light and fluffy.
– 1 Β½ tsp baking soda β Reacts for moist crumb.
– 1 tsp salt β Balances sweetness.
– 2 eggs β Binds and adds richness.
– 1 cup milk β Moistens the batter.
– Β½ cup oil β Keeps layers soft.
– 2 tsp vanilla β Enhances aroma.
– 1 cup boiling water β Blooms cocoa for depth.
– 2 cups fresh raspberries β Provides tart filling.
– Β½ cup sugar β For raspberry filling sweetness.
– 2 tbsp cornstarch β Thickens filling.
– 1 cup butter β Base for creamy frosting.
– 4 cups powdered sugar β Sweetens buttercream.
– Β½ cup cocoa β Chocolaty frosting.
– ΒΌ cup milk β Smooths frosting.
– 1 tsp vanilla β Flavors buttercream.
– 1 cup cream β For silky ganache.
– 8 oz chopped chocolate β Tops with shine.
Instructions
1-First Step: Prep the Pans and Oven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Grease two 9-inch round pans with butter or oil, line bottoms with parchment. This prevents sticking and ensures easy release. Total prep here takes 10 minutes.
2-Second Step: Mix Dry Ingredients for Cake Whisk 2 cups flour, 1 ΒΎ cups sugar, ΒΎ cup cocoa powder, 1 Β½ tsp baking powder, 1 Β½ tsp baking soda, and 1 tsp salt in a large bowl. This dry mix sets the foundation. For gluten-free, use a 1:1 blend now.
3-Third Step: Add Wet Ingredients Add 2 eggs, 1 cup milk, Β½ cup oil, and 2 tsp vanilla. Beat on medium until combined, about 2 minutes. Vegan swap: use flax eggs and plant milk. Stir in 1 cup boiling water last; batter will thin but bake moist.
4-Fourth Step: Bake the Layers Divide batter evenly between pans. Bake 30-35 minutes until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ool in pans 10 minutes, then transfer to racks. Full cooling takes 1 hour; rushing causes crumbling.
5-Fifth Step: Cook the Filling Combine 2 cups fresh raspberries, Β½ cup sugar, and 2 tbsp cornstarch in saucepan. Cook over medium heat, stirring, until thickened (5-7 minutes). Frozen berries? Thaw and drain first. Cool completely for assembly.
6-Sixth Step: Whip Chocolate Buttercream Beat 1 cup softened butter until creamy. Gradually add 4 cups powdered sugar, Β½ cup cocoa, ΒΌ cup milk, 1 tsp vanilla. Beat until fluffy, 3-5 minutes. Low-cal tip: halve amounts.
7-Seventh Step: Prepare Ganache Heat 1 cup cream until simmering, pour over 8 oz chopped chocolate. Stir until smooth. Let cool 10 minutes to thicken.
8-Final Step: Assemble and Chill Place one cake layer on plate, spread raspberry filling, then buttercream. Top with second layer, frost sides and top. Drizzle ganache. Chill 30 minutes. Serves 12; slice and enjoy. For cupcakes, bake 20 minutes.
Notes
π« Use room-temperature ingredients for the cake batter to ensure even mixing and a tender crumb.
π Press fresh raspberries gently when making filling to retain juices without over-mashing for texture.
βοΈ Assemble cake a day ahead; the flavors meld beautifully, and store covered in the fridge for up to 3 days.
